The Resemblance is Uncanny

Makeup Revolution is a new cosmetics brand in the UK and since its launch; the eye palettes that have really caught people’s attention are the iconic palettes that are the perfect dupes of the Urban Decay Naked palettes.

It’s not hard to see the solid resemblance between them but there is one distinct difference between them; while the Naked palettes can go for about £37, the iconic palettes go for a staggering £4, and they have just about the same quality in pigmentation and staying power.

If you live in the UK and you’ve wanted to get your hands on all or any of the Naked palettes, but couldn’t because of the steep price, then I’d recommend that you look into these dupe palettes.

REVIEW | L.A Girls PRO Conceal HD Concealer and Swatches

This is the PRO Conceal HD Concealer from L.A Girls in the shade Cool Tan ‘GC980’.

 Swatch

Blanded

I bought this concealer with the intention of using it as a highlighter, but in truth I think I got the wrong shade for my complexion.

The concealer comes equipped with it’s own brush to make applying it to your skin easier. I wouldn’t recommend that you try to blend the concealer with that brush though, it doesn’t do a great job at it. So just grab a concealer brush and use that to blend. Another thing, don’t take too long after applying it to your skin to blend it, it’s hard enough to get it blended as is.

Since this isn’t my shade, it makes me look ‘ghosted out’ when ever I use it, as you can see in the swatch, so I can’t really comment much on the colour pay-off. But even still, the times where I’ve used it under my eyes it really muted the bags that were there.

Overall I think that this is a good concealer, a bit on the hard side to blend though and it’s easy to apply to the skin. I’d repurchase it, but in the right shade next time – hopefully.

AVON ANEW Platinum Eye and Lip | FIRST IMPRESSIONS

This is the first product that I’ve ever tried from AVON. It was gifted to me from a friend on my birthday last Thursday. This eye and lip cream comes from AVON’s ANEW line of products and what it does is that it helps to stimulate the production of a key skin protein responsible for youthful cell shape (paxillin). It also helps to recontour the look of the eye and lip area.

(In a study) After 3 days, 86% felt the appearance of deep vertical lines above and below the lips were visibly filled in. In 2 weeks, 85% agreed eyes have a more reshaped look and youthful definition.

The cream comes with an applicator. The round silver end for application around the eyes and the flat end the application on and around the lips. Applying the cream is very easy, and with how little product I was able to use to do both my eyes and lips this product should last me well past two weeks – I barely made a dent. The cream has an aloe scent and it’s pretty simple to use, you don’t have to get your hands messy to use it.

My Go-To Powder Foundation

Hello everyone!

In today’s post I’ll be telling you about my current go to pressed powder foundation. The powder foundation that I find myself grabbing for the most lately is this ‘Amuse Pressed Powder’.

It’s very easy to apply and it allows you to build up to your preferred coverage. Being able to chose from sheer, to medium to full coverage on any given day with just one product is something that is very appealing to me and I can just put on more in the areas where I usually get oily (the dreaded T).

This does come with a sponge, but in my opinion, the sponges that powder compacts come with don’t offer much flexibility in the application process. The sponges give you instant full coverage and are not too great for blending.

The powder has a slight florally-ish smell to it, nothing that’s prominent and hardly even noticeable.

Overall it’s one of my favourite pressed powders.
